gov.sg - the official LinkedIn page of the Singapore government. We bring you: - Policy updates, highlighting their implications for Singaporean businesses and workers - Tips and experts' take on government initiatives - Relevant information on schemes and grants for SMEs - Budget news and analysis - Stories about Singaporean entrepreneurs - And many more Most of all, we want to connect with you and understand your views on socio-economic issues that affect Singapore today. Leave a comment on any of our posts – we’ll love to hear from you! We welcome constructive feedback and discussions on issues. Postings which breach our community guidelines and LinkedIn’s Professional Community Policies will be removed. These include those containing foul language; objectionable content such as personal attacks, hate speech and discrimination; violence, terrorism and criminal behaviour; nudity and pornography; spam, advertisements or scams as well as misinformation and fake news. Followers who breach the above-mentioned guidelines may be given a warning and/or banned from the page.
